Electric Radiant Heating
Electric radiant heating is a system that uses electrical resistance elements, such as cables, mats, or panels, to generate heat that radiates directly to objects and people in a space, providing efficient and comfortable warmth. It is commonly installed in floors, walls, or ceilings, offering silent operation and even heat distribution without the need for ductwork or forced air. This technology is often used in residential and commercial buildings for supplemental or primary heating, particularly in areas like bathrooms, kitchens, or rooms with high ceilings.
